Dine Contract Catering snaps up Midlands-based operator
Independent caterer Dine Contract Catering has snapped up Midlands-based Quartet Catering, adding 13 sites to its national portfolio.
The Warrington-based caterer, led by managing director ian Cartwright, currently has nearly 170 sites in the business & industry (B&I), care, and further education sectors, and 950 employees.
B&I caterer Quartet, which turned over £1.8m in 2013, brings a 60-strong workforce to the Dine payroll under TUPE.
The current management is expected to remain in place, while the Quartet branding will remain for the foreseeable future.
Commenting on the acquisition, for an undisclosed sum, Cartwright said: "Quartet Catering's portfolio in B&I has strong synergies to our own.
"The acquisition will give Quartet's customers and staff some significant benefits in line with our operating ethos including the implementation of our health and wellness programme to help drive awareness of the value of employees making informed choices across their eating habits.
"We will also be introducing personalised training programmes for all staff, to drive motivation, progression and opportunity."
